Brick Hardscaping in Warwick, RI
Brick hardscaping services encompass the design, installation, and repair of durable outdoor features constructed with brick materials. This includes projects such as patios, walkways, driveways, retaining walls, fire pits, and outdoor seating areas. Homeowners often seek these services to enhance the functionality and aesthetic appeal of their outdoor spaces, creating inviting areas for relaxation and entertainment. Before requesting brick hardscaping, property owners typically want to understand the scope of the project, the types of bricks or pavers suitable for their climate and style preferences, and the overall durability and maintenance requirements of the materials used.
It is important for property owners to consider factors such as the intended use of the space, existing landscape conditions, and any local building codes or restrictions that may influence the project. Understanding the available design options, the longevity of different brick styles, and the estimated costs involved can help in planning a successful hardscaping project. Clear communication of these details can ensure that the finished result aligns with the homeowner’s vision and functional needs for their property.

Brick Hardscaping Questions
What types of projects are suitable for brick hardscaping? Brick hardscaping is ideal for patios, walkways, retaining walls, and garden borders around Warwick properties.
How durable is brick for outdoor use? Brick is a long-lasting material that withstands weather conditions and heavy foot traffic when properly installed.
What are common design options for brick hardscaping? Designs can include traditional patterns, herringbone, or running bond layouts to complement various landscape styles.
Is brick hardscaping maintenance-intensive? Brick features generally require minimal upkeep, with occasional cleaning and repairs for mortar joints if needed.
